Overview

Kepler-679 b is an exoplanet orbiting the star Kepler-679, discovered in 2016 using the Transit method. It is a Mini-Neptune world.

System Context

Kepler-679 b orbits Kepler-679 and was reported in 2016 and was detected with the Transit method.

Published measurements list a radius of 3.01 Earth radii, a mass of 9.92 Earth masses (estimated), and an orbital period of 12.39 days.

Catalog data places the system at about 922.2 parsecs from Earth and 1 known planet in the system.
